Below are a selection of resources for newcomers to Winnipeg and Manitoba.
- New to Manitoba? The Welcome to Canada app will help ease your settlement journey by connecting you to information and services in your area. You can find information on housing, employment, and so much more.
- New Journey Housing – Agency that helps newcomers to Canada with their housing concerns including finding a rental, understanding a tenant's rights and responsibilities, and even managing their finances. To book an appointment pre-arrival in Canada to discuss rental housing, contact info

- Manitoba 211 is a searchable online database of government, health, and social services that are available across the province.
